9+ Southwest Airlines Flight 302: Info & Insights

This specific air travel identifier refers to a Boeing 737-700 operating a scheduled domestic passenger service from New York City’s LaGuardia Airport to Dallas Love Field on April 17, 2018. The flight experienced an uncontained engine failure at approximately 32,000 feet, leading to debris striking the fuselage and causing a rapid decompression. This event necessitated an emergency landing at Philadelphia International Airport.

The incident became a significant case study in aviation safety, prompting investigations by the National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) and the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A). The resulting analyses led to enhanced safety protocols and regulations regarding engine maintenance and inspection procedures, ultimately influencing the development of improved aircraft designs and emergency response strategies within the aviation industry. This event highlighted the critical interplay between mechanical integrity, crew resource management, and passenger safety.

Alaska Airlines Flight 661: Tragedy & Investigation

This specific air travel designation refers to a scheduled passenger flight operated by Alaska Airlines on January 31, 2000, that tragically crashed into the Pacific Ocean near Point Mugu, California. The aircraft, a McDonnell Douglas MD-83, was en route from Puerto Vallarta, Mexico, to Seattle-Tacoma International Airport with 83 passengers and 5 crew members on board. The accident stemmed from the failure of a jackscrew assembly controlling the horizontal stabilizer, leading to a loss of pitch control.

The event holds significant importance in aviation history due to the subsequent investigations and resulting safety recommendations. The National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) conducted an extensive inquiry, ultimately leading to changes in aircraft maintenance procedures and component design. The disaster highlighted the critical need for enhanced oversight of critical aircraft systems and improved communication between airlines and regulatory bodies. The tragedy spurred advancements in flight data recorder technology and analysis techniques, ultimately contributing to improved aviation safety standards worldwide.
